前言
二维码是一种特殊的条形码,它由黑白相间的像素组成,可以存储更多的信息。二维码可以被扫描器或相机扫描并读取,提供了一种快速便捷的方式将信息传输到移动设备或计算机上。二维码广泛应用于支付、电商、物流、广告等领域。
凯撒密码是一种简单的替换密码,它是由古罗马军队统帅凯撒使用的一种密码,它的原理是将明文中的每个字母按照固定的偏移量替换成另一个字母,通常是将明文中的每个字母向后移动三个位置,并用替换后的字母组成密文。例如,将明文“HELLO”替换为“KHOOR”。凯撒密码很容易破解,因为只有26种可能的偏移量。
ASCII是一种字符编码标准,全称为American Standard Code for Information Interchange(美国信息交换标准代码)。它是将常用的字符和符号分别用数字来表示,以便计算机存储和传输。 ASCII编码使用7位二进制数来表示每个字符,共计128个字符,包括英文字母、数字、标点符号及一些控制字符。 ASCII编码在计算机通讯、文件传输、文本编辑等领域得到广泛应用,并被现代计算机系统所支持和继承。
一、二维码数据分析
1.打开题目
2.解题
扫描6个二维码得到字符串:ZPV!BSF!B!SFBMMZ!IBDLJOH!CPZ<*
凯撒位移一位得到
YOU!ARE!A!REALLY!HACKING!BOY<*
符号进行ASCII位移
得到flag:YOU ARE A REALLY HACKING BOY;)